## Shared Lab Access — Dellwick Building, Floor 2

The Hydrion team shares Lab 2C with our colleagues from the Calveth Instruments group. Assistants booking lab time must confirm the slot in the shared calendar at least one working day ahead, note any equipment required, and ensure visitors are escorted at all times. Entry is via the east corridor keypad, using the code shown below.

staff pass of kawip-hawef = bdg-QLP-2

Subject: Heads up — DR drill for Stackpulse autoscaler on Thursday

Hi support folks, quick note: we're running a disaster-recovery drill on the Stackpulse queue-depth autoscaler Thursday morning. Expect some fake alerts and a brief scaling pause — no customer impact, so no tickets needed. If anyone has to check drill status, the readonly dashboard is locked during the exercise. Unlock it with the recovery passphrase below.

unlock words, yawig-kagef: gordor-holvan-ulaael-pramir-ulaiel-tamdor

// Notes for the weekly eng sync re: Gallerywhisper, our museum audio-guide app.
// This constant sets the prefetch radius for exhibit audio clips. At the
// Hollen Pavilion pilot we learned visitors walk faster than our original
// estimate, so clips were buffering mid-stride. Bumping this to three rooms
// ahead fixed it, at a modest bandwidth cost. Don't lower it without testing
// on the slow gallery wifi first — seriously, it's painful. The trace token
// from the pilot build that validated this number is appended just below.

trace token, kahap-bagaf: htk4_8458

Finance Review — Harrowgate Franchise Agreement

The Dunmore Kitchens franchise deal closed at a 6% royalty with a reduced setup fee. Payback modelled at 14 months. Territory covers Harrowgate and two adjacent districts. Marketing contribution capped at 2% of gross. Sales leads should prioritise supporting the launch window. Note the strategic context recorded below.

internal memo for kagup-hahof: The northern region missed its Briix quota by 44.1 percent last quarter. Pelixek Freight plans to raise the Gorael list price by 50.0 percent in September. The finance team signed off on a budget of $502.5 million for Project Ralys. The renewal with Quenionax Works closes at $163.8 million a year, 15.3 percent above the last contract.